What the Filing Says About Pineapple Energy, Inc. Employee Stock Ownership Plan and Trust

Pineapple Energy, Inc. Employee Stock Ownership Plan and Trust is a Other retirement plan sponsored by Pineapple Energy, Inc, headquartered in Minnesota. As of the 2024 Form 5500 filing, the plan reports $33K in total end-of-year assets and covers 35 participants across the Information & Media industry. The sponsor's EIN on file with the U.S. Department of Labor is 410957999, and the plan has been effective since 1985-01-01. Its filing status is currently FILING RECEIVED.

Year over year, total assets moved from $86K at the beginning of 2024 to $33K at year-end — a decline of 61.8%. Net assets (after liabilities) closed the year at $33K, with reported net income of $-53,051 driven by investment returns, contributions received, and benefit payments during the period. These figures reflect what the plan administrator certified on Schedule H or Schedule I of the Form 5500 annual return and can be compared against 2 prior plan-year filings from the same sponsor shown below.
